Quicktime Updater should ONLY be used to push updates

From a user standpoint it enrages me that you use the quicktime update application to push the use of iTunes. It is not the role of an update mechanism to push the adoption of other software but purely to distribute updates to existing applications. At the very least there should be an option to never harass me again about iTunes and to only prompt me to update installed applications. Your current practices amount to adware rather than an update mechanism. Put on the other foot, how would Apple react to the idea of MS providing an update mechanism in Office that prompted users to install a mac compatible instance of the Zune software (this is a hypothetical; I realize there is not a OS X zune client)? I don't think that would be seen in a great light by you folks in cuportino.
From a security standpoint, this is a counter productive approach. Subverting your updater as a means to advertise products and push adoption encourages a subset of users to disable the mechanism and resolve to manually apply updates. You are in essence encouraging a subset of your users to actively disable your update mechanism. Considering the regularity that security flaws are found in quicktime this is a dangerous move.
I really believe that quicktime is becoming the real player that was so prevelant several years ago; the nagging, invasive piece of software that ignored basic customer satisfaction in the hopes of strongarming adoption. I used to install quicktime on every machine I used; now it is installed on precisely one machine and only for the purpose of watching movie trailers. As Yahoo offers more and more trailers in WMP friendly format the likely hood that even this one machine will keep quicktime is deminishing. Finding all of the icons I deleted from my desktop, start menu, and quick launch bar restored after an update motivates me all the more.
So at this point I propose Apple decide whether they wish their software to satisfy their customer, or if they would rather just use it as a trojan distribution method to stongarm product adoption. Hopefully it is the former, but at the rate things are going it looks to be the latter and if the anti-customer practice continues I believe you are going to start losing customers. It wasn't WMP that killed real player after all; it was real player.

  • Windows Update Client failed to detect with error 0xc8000247 after using Lenovo System Update 5

    My Windows 7, SP1 was running fine, until I installed few updates on 10/15 using Lenovo System Update 5 then Windows Update stopped working, shows as RED:

    Lenovo Thinkpad W500, Intel (R), Windows 7, SP1, latest updates as of Oct 15
    (1) Checked Setting,  set to automatic update whenever, even changed to never update, rebooted the OS and changed back to automatic update and rebooted the OS.
    (2) Stopped Windows Update Services, renamed SoftwareDistribution folder and started the window update services and rebooted.
    (3) Ran MS FIXIT
    (4) Ran System File checker Scan (sfc /scannow)
    (5) Ran CHKDSK /F
    (6) Installed "Intel Rapid Storage Technology" drivers from Lenovo site
    (7) Ran Update for Windows 7 for x64-based Systems (KB971033)
    None of the above possible recommended solutions were able to fix the issue yet and now I am getting a message your Window is Not Genuine!
    Any help or guidance is appreciated.
    Solved!
    Go to Solution.

    The Lenovo System Update installed the "Intel Matrix Storage Manager driver 8.9.2.1002" right before the Windows Upgrade got broken. So in the Device Manager under IDE ATA/ATAPI Controllers, I choose Intel ICH9M-E/M SATA AHCI Controller, on the Driver Tab, I choose the option "Roll Back Driver" and after rolling back the driver and restarting the OS, now Windows Update is working like a Champ!

  • Hyy i m using ipad and i want to upgrade it to latest os update 8 but when i tried to update it got updated only to 5.1.1 what should i do to get further update??

    hyy i m using ipad and i want to upgrade it to latest os update 8 but when i tried to update it got updated only to 5.1.1 what should i do to get further update??

    If your iPad has no front or back cameras, then you have an original iPad 1.
    The original iPad 1 cannot be upgraded any further than iOS 5.1.1.
    Sorry.

  • My daughter sold me this iPad now when I update instead of it using my appleid and password it always tries to use hers! I can't update or do anything important with my own appleid what should I do! And she can't remember the password she

    MY daughter sold me this iPad! When I go to update it always tries to use her appleid instead of mine!! She has forgot the password to this account what should I do! Because it says it's hooked up to my Id but when I try to update itsail ways says her I'd information

    Is this when updating apps or the iPad's iOS version ? If apps then any apps that your daughter downloaded onto the iPad will be tied to her account, so only her account can download updates to those apps (you would need to delete the apps and buy/download them with your own account to be able to download future updates to them with your account) then she could try getting her password reset via http://iforgot.apple.com
    If you are trying to update the iOS version on it and she's left it tied to her iCloud account then with iOS 7 and activation lock only her account will be able to re-activate the iPad. She can try getting her password reset via the above iforgot link.

  • Should using the software update service be faster for the clients then downloading from apple?

    I've got about 25 clients, a mixture of Snow Leopard and Lion systems in the office. I've recently turned on the Software update service on my snow leopard server (10.6.8, mac mini) and have a transparent server setup for the software updates service (dns redirects through the mini). All the machines see the mini and I believe they are pulling updates from it when the client runs their software update. I haven't noticed any real speed differnce though from pulling updates from the mini vs pulling from apple (though I have noticed less internet congestion).
    Should this be faster because it's a local network transfer or not?
    Thanks!

    I'm a little concerned by the statement:
    dns redirects through the mini
    Are you saying you're masking Apple's DNS so that requests for swupdate.apple.com end up on your machine? That's the wrong approach. You should be setting the client's preferences to load from your server instead of Apple's.
    In either case, there are three components to running Software Updaate.
    1: download the catalog of available updates and compare what's installed to the list to identify which updates are needed
    2: download the appropriate updates
    3: install the updates.
    Of the three steps, downloading the catalog is a lightweight process - the index is only a few hundred KB, so the difference in loading this from your server vs. Apple's is minimal. Additionally, this won't make any difference in the amount of time it takes the client to scan for which updates are needed since that's all work performed locally on the machine.
    The only step that will be significantly faster is the actual downloading of available updates. These should happen at LAN speeds, rather than your internet connection speed (which is, presumably, slower), but then again, most updates are fairly small - a few megabytes is typical.
    However, if no updates are available, or if they're only small, you won't see much difference in time between local and remote. The main advantage of using a local software update server is that you only need to download the updates from Apple once, rather than once per client.

  • I am considering switching from MIE to Firefox. But I need to use an outdated version (7.3.1) of QuickTime, and I do not want Firefox to update it. If I installed Firefox, how would I prevent this?

    I am considering switching from MIE to Firefox. But I need to use an outdated version (7.3.1) of QuickTime, and I do not want Firefox to update it. If I installed Firefox, how would I prevent this?

    Firefox doesn't update plugins like that. The worst you might see is a "nag" from Firefox after an update, about that plugin being outdated; and you can dismiss that "nag" by just closing it.
